Peacefully at the Prince Edward Home, Charlottetown, surrounded by his family, we announce the passing of Erroll Bagnall of Hazel Grove on Saturday, May 23, 2015, at the age of 84. A cherished husband, father, grandfather and great-grandfather, he leaves to mourn his loving wife of 62 years, Leone (MacKay); daughters Elaine (Leith) Orr, Carol (Doug) Willoughby, Donna (Tim) Stanley; sons Lloyd (Elisse), John (Bethany); grandchildren Michael and Jeremy Orr, Scott and Marisa Willoughby, Vanessa and Sarah Stanley, Brandon, Justin, Jason and Jaxon Bagnall; great-grandsons Easton and Jax Bagnall; and many nieces and nephews. Erroll was predeceased by his parents, Pope and Annie (Pound) Bagnall; brothers, Ellsworth, Reagh, Eric and Borden; and sisters, May, Pauline and Rhoda. During his lifetime, Erroll was active in his community, the Masonic Lodge and the Hunter River Lions Club.
